Grow is a small town located in Rusk County, Wisconsin, in the United States. In the year 2000, about 473 people lived there.
Geography
Grow is a town that covers an area of about 35.4 square miles (which is about 91.7 square kilometers). All of this area is land, meaning there are no large lakes or rivers within the town's official borders.
Who Lives in Grow?
Based on information from the year 2000, there were 473 people living in Grow. These people lived in 160 different homes, and 127 of these were families.
The town had about 13.4 people living in each square mile. Most of the people living in Grow were white. A very small number were African American or Asian. Some people were also of Hispanic or Latino background.
Many homes in Grow had children under 18 years old. About 65% of the homes were married couples living together. Some homes were led by a single mother.
The people in Grow were of different ages. About one-third of the population was under 18 years old. About 14% of the people were 65 years old or older. The average age in the town was 35 years.
The average yearly income for a family in Grow was about $40,000. For individuals, the average income was around $13,133 per year. Some families and individuals in Grow lived below the poverty line. This included some children and older adults.
